Fairfax County Public Schools released the 2019 high school graduation schedule on Thursday.

Edison and West Potomac are again among the 17 FCPS schools holding their graduations at at George Mason University. Bryant, Hayfield, Mount Vernon and Quander Road will be hosting their own ceremonies.

The schedule for all Richmond Highway-area schools:

Bryant High School
Thursday, June 6 at 4 p.m.
Location: Bryant High School

Edison High School
Monday, June 10 at 7:30 p.m.
Location: Eagle Bank Arena

Hayfield Secondary School
Friday, June 7 at 4:30 p.m
Location: Hayfield Secondary School

Mount Vernon High School
Friday, June 7 at 2 p.m.
Location: Mount Vernon High School

Pulley Career Center
Friday, May 31 at 10 a.m.
Location: West Potomac High School

Quander Road School
Thursday, May 30 at 3:30 p.m.
Location: Quander Road School

West Potomac High School
Thursday, June 6 at 2 p.m.
Location: Eagle Bank Arena
